Carriage on Purchases is Carriage Inward

Answer: It is true that the carriage of purchases is inward.

Explanation:

To put it another way, “carriage inwards” refers to the transportation costs that must be paid by the buyer when it receives merchandise ordered with terms FOB shipping point. The terms “freight-in” and “transportation-in” can refer to the same thing. Expenses incurred in transporting goods into the country are included in the purchase price.
